Sunday Book Review
I just received from Artisan Books This Is Who I Am -- Our Beauty In All Shapes and Sizes by Rosanne Olson,and it brought tears of sorrow and tears of joy to my eyes. This is an honest, raw, and naked photographic assessment of 54 ordinary women, ranging in ages from 19 to 95 , women in all shapes and sizes who share their most intimate feelings about their bodies.
The 54 confident and generous women agreed to pose nude for photographer Rosanne Olson to combat media's stereotype of beauty: slim hips, full breasts, high cheekbones, tiny waists, taut skin, and eternal youth. By sharing their very personal stories, they hoped it would help other women find the real beauty in their own selves.
Olson's artfully taken portrait of each woman is accompanied by a story that is sometimes deeply intimate. Meet Michelle, 58, a breast cancer survivor; Jessica, 29, a recovering anorexic; and Alice, 95, a senior citizen:
Michelle, 58, breast cancer survivor -
"When I go out without my wig, all people see is my bald head, and it scares them. Luckily, I've found that the more I open my heart to other people, the easier maintaining my weight and adapting to being bald becomes. We all have something. Mine's just more obvious."
Jessica, 29, recovering anorexic -
"I never thought it was okay to love my body, and I couldn't say it was beautiful, because even if even one person didn't agree, then it couldn't be true. I felt as though my body was owned by the outside world."
Alice, 95, senior citizen -
"At my age, pain frustrates me. But I'm to busy to dwell on problems. This is the body I was given, and it has served me well. I never thought about loving it, but I have accepted it."
This Is Who I Am - Our Beauty in All Shapes and Sizesis a powerfulprimer of persuasion to love your body at any age, any shape, any size... You should share this with your mother, your daughter, your friends.
